Erscheinungsdatum: | 2026 | Tag der mündlichen Prüfung: | 2026-05-18 | Zusammenfassung: | Peripheral immune profiling in glioblastoma patients revealed profound systemic alterations with features of both immune activation and suppression. Increased T-cell metabolic activity and reduced T-cell exhaustion point to immune activation, while diminished pro-inflammatory cytokines, activated and less exhausted Tregs, and reduced NK cells reflect immune suppression. Recurrent glioblastomas showed even more pronounced abnormalities, including a shift toward TH2 responses, pointing to increasing immune dysfunction with disease progression. Several parameters correlated with patient survival. Higher CD8+CD73+ expression and increased conventional CD4+ T cells were associated with better outcomes, whereas elevated CD8+TIGIT+ and Treg HLA-DR correlated with poorer prognosis. These findings suggest that the dismal prognosis of glioblastoma patients, with a failure of anti-tumor immunity, may result from an imbalance of systemic immune activation and suppression. Targeting this systemic immune dysfunction may provide novel therapeutic opportunities to restore effective anti-tumor immunity in glioblastoma patients. Markers correlating with survival, such as TIGIT, may be of special interest. |
